Abstract

The invention discloses a fault diagnosis device for photoelectric detection equipment based on PSO optimized neural network, which comprises a device body, a hydraulic cylinder is installed at the corner of the device body, a hydraulic oil pump is installed at the bottom of the hydraulic cylinder, and a hydraulic oil pump is installed at the bottom of the hydraulic oil pump. Oil tank, the telescopic end of the hydraulic cylinder is equipped with a gear box, a motor is installed on one side of the gear box, and a diagnostic equipment is installed on the other side of the gear box, and a lighting lamp is installed on the top of the diagnostic equipment. A diagnostic cover is arranged on one side, a diagnostic instrument is installed at the bottom of the diagnostic cover, and a sealing gasket is installed at the top of the diagnostic cover. The fault diagnosis device for photoelectric detection equipment of the present invention can quickly adjust the height, and can diagnose the photoelectric detection equipment on wall tops and walls with different heights, has good diagnostic effect, strong sensitivity, can be moved to any position, and has strong flexibility , It can automatically extend the computer and data equipment, which is convenient for the staff to use.

technical field [0001] The invention relates to the field of photoelectric detection equipment, in particular to a fault diagnosis device for photoelectric detection equipment based on a PSO optimized neural network. Background technique [0002] The principle of a photodetector is that radiation causes a change in the conductivity of the irradiated material. Photodetectors are widely used in various fields of military and national economy. In the visible or near-infrared band, it is mainly used for ray measurement and detection, industrial automatic control, photometry, etc.; in the infrared band, it is mainly used for missile guidance, infrared thermal imaging, infrared remote sensing, etc. Another application of the photoconductor is to use it as the target surface of the camera tube.
